( B) DAY 6 Located near the town of Sawai Madhophur, Ranthambhor National Park is an excellent example of Project Tiger’s work. The park itself consists of 400 square kilometres of dry deciduous forest, the ideal natural habitat for tigers. As well as tigers, Ranthambhor has large numbers of sambar, chital and nilgai.
